Within the first few minutes of wandering around campus, we spotted a group of seniors playing catch. Among them was our first street-style snap of the year.

Upon seeing her baseball glove we had flashbacks to Alexander Wang’s S/S 2010 collection, where models were sent down the runway with sports equipment for accessories. Adding to the masculine appeal were her worn in pair of combat boots. The feminine addition of her Chanel-like jacket topped off a minimal, yet playful ensemble.

We have seen plenty of ombre tresses on campus this year, but upon seeing Steph, we saw how she made the hair trend her own. After ogling her hair, we were struck by Steph’s vintage vibe. She perfectly pulled off the oversize look, which one could claim to be a reaction to the previous years’ domination by body-con silhouettes.

Being extremely stylish and comfortable is a hard thing to do, and Steph definitely pulled it off!

About to call it a day, we decided to head back to our vehicles. While passing the Canal Building we saw a flash of pink, which led us to Xeyuo, an exchange student from China! Mixing prints like a pro, Xeyuo also skillfully mixed a transitional outfit. As fall approaches, we have noticed many students seemingly jumping headfirst into winter wear. Xeyou avoided the seasonal confusion by adding fall touches, like her socks and thick cardigan, to her otherwise summery outfit.

Xeyou’s prints are reminiscent of a Rachel Comey-like pairing, and show her knack for creating an unexpected, yet, pulled together outfit.
